Gazpacho Gazpacho




6 ripe tomatoes, peeled and chopped
1 purple onion, finely chopped
1 cucumber, peeled, seeded, chopped
1 sweet red bell pepper (or green) seeded and chopped
2 stalks celery, chopped
1-2 Tbsp chopped fresh parsley
2 Tbsp chopped fresh chives
1 clove garlic, minced
1/4 cup red wine vinegar
1/4 cup olive oil
2 Tbsp freshly squeezed lemon juice
2 teaspoons sugar
Salt and fresh ground pepper to taste
6 or more drops of Tabasco sauce to taste
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
4 cups tomato juice

Combine all ingredients. Blend slightly, to desired consistency. Place in non-metal, non-reactive storage container, cover tightly and refrigerate overnight, allowing flavors to blend.

Serves 8.


SERVE ICE COLD!!

catbox_9 wrote:
How do you peel a tomato?

Plunge a tomato into a pot of boiling water for 5-10 second dip; occasionally, a stubborn tomato will require 15 seconds, but only rarely. Even better is a quick scorching of the skins over a gas flame, the tomato stuck on the tines of a fork. Turn the fork quickly so that the flesh doesn't begin to cook; it takes about five to fifteen seconds per tomato, depending on size. A water bath will dilute the flavor of the tomato slightly; the flame will intensify the taste.

With either method, set the tomatoes aside until they are cool enough to handle; the skins will pull away easily. Do not put tomatoes in a cold water bath to cool them; it will only serve to further dilute the flavor.
